2014-11-12 6 views
1

Я пытаюсь установить Ioncube Loader с XAMPP и PHP 5.5. Мне нужно это для XT Commerce на моей локальной машине. Но я не могу установить его правильно. После загрузки из http://www.ioncube.com/loaders.php распаковать эту папкуIoncube Loader PHP 5.5 не установлен

C:\xampp\htdocs\ioncube 

После этого я открываю страницу Test (http://localhost/ioncube/loader-wizard.php?page=loader_check) и я получаю ошибки как:

The following problem has been found with the Loader installation: 

    The necessary zend_extension line could not be found in the configuration file, C:\xampp\php\php.ini. 

Так что я добавить эту строку в мой PHP .ini:

zend_extension = "C:\xampp\htdocs\ioncube\ioncube_loader_win_5.5.dll" 

Я перезапускаю свой сервер Apache и повторю попытку. Но теперь я не получаю ошибки ... но и сообщение, которое Iconcube не правильно установить:

Ioncube Loader Wizard

Ioncube погрузчик в настоящее время не установлен успешно.

Проверьте, что программное обеспечение веб-сервера Apache было перезапущено.

Так что же теперь? Как установить загрузчик ioncube 5.5?

+0

Я понимаю. Теперь я использую установку с установщиком загрузчика с этой страницы: https: //www.ioncube.com/loaders.php, и теперь он работает ...: -O – goldlife

+0

Замечательно, что он работает! – Nick

+0

Loader - это .exe-файл. Как насчет решения этой проблемы для mac. Получил эту ошибку от использования мастера, чтобы это не помогло. –

ответ

1

IonCube имеет готовое решение, которое ведет вас шаг за шагом. Просто используйте мастер/установки с их страницы:

Установка с Loader Installer или Loader Wizard (рекомендуется)

Рекомендуется установить погрузчик с помощью загрузчика программы установки. Установщик - это приложение Windows, которое может автоматически загружать загрузчик в любую поддерживаемую операционную систему через FTP или SFTP. Если это не может быть использовано, мы также предоставляем PHP-скрипт Loader Wizard, который дает руководство по установке вручную.

Loader Installer: ZIP

Мастер Грузчик: ZIP TGZ

Чтобы использовать мастер, 1) скачать и установить скрипт на ваш веб пространства, то 2) запустить скрипт в вашем браузере. Мастер даст руководство по выбору и установке правильного пакета Loader.

Источник и дополнительная информация: http://www.ioncube.com/loaders.php

+2

Это сообщение об ошибке из мастера Loader Wizard. –

0

проверить, если версия Apache компиляции VC9 или VC11 и скачать нужный пакет

Вам нужно добавить строки в php.ini и скопировать библиотеки DLL из этих путей:

zend_extension = "\xampp\php\ioncube\ioncube_loader_win_5.5.dll"<br> 
zend_extension_ts = "\xampp\php\zendOptimizer\lib\ZendExtensionManager.dll" 

и сброс Apache

+0

Отредактировано ваше сообщение, чтобы исправить опечатки и ошибки. zend_extension_ts был удален из PHP в PHP 5.3, а Zend Optimiser не имеет значения. Рекомендуется использовать установщик Loader, как это сделал OP с успехом, но не мешает узнать, что такое базовое изменение. – Nick